Abstract

Soybean seeds are produced in various states of the country and high levels of productivity have been achieved, especially in the Southeast and Midwest. However, several environmental factors such as temperature, relative humidity of air, altitude, pluvial precipitation and phytosanitary conditions have limited the obtainment of seeds with satisfactory physiological and sanitary quality in some regions. Therefore, the choice of regions with favorable climate conditions for each cultivar can lead to the production of higher quality seed. Thus, this research aims to evaluate the physiological, sanitary and chemical quality of soybean cultivars seeds harvested at production sites with different soil and climatic characteristics and the influence of genotype-environment relationship. Furthermore, it will be evaluated the physiological potential and seed viability after storage. It will be used seeds of two soybean cultivars early cycle (M-SOY 7908 RR and CD 2630 RR) from four regions with different edaphoclimatic characteristics. Each region and cultivar will be represented for five seed lots. The influence of factors such as temperature, relative humidity of air, pests and diseases relevant to each region will be evaluated by the germination and vigor tests (accelerated aging, electrical conductivity and tetrazolium), as well as the verification of mechanical damage by sodium hypochlorite test, sanity test and determination of the chemical composition of the seeds. After determining the seed quality, seeds will be stored in a dry chamber (20 ± 2 °C and 45% RH of air) for six months to verify the viability and vigor maintenance. (AU)
